Member: 130995 Status: Offline Thanks Meter: 35,228 | I have repeated easy explanation at least 100 (one hundred) times already: you must open phone and see CPU chip name. If CPU chip name is like MT62xx then this phone is supported ! Another instruction was repeated in this forum at least 1000 (one thousand) times: Currently many "Chinese" models with the same name but absolutely different hardware exist on market, f.e. exist at least 20 phones with name "Chinese Nokia-N95" but with different bottom connectors and different pinouts, so we recommend you to include the next information in your question regarding pinout: 1. detailed description of model: brand name, model name, complete text from phone back label, any other marks that you can find on phone cover 2. phone CPU chip name 3. phone PCB photo (Rx/Tx/Gnd test-points may exist on phone PCB) 4. attach phone photo 5. attach phone bottom connector photo 6. include information about Gnd and Charge pins on phone bottom connector After you have this information prepared, you can find pinout by yourself more easy than before, just check the next detailed description how to get pinout for your model: 1. use "Cable Selector": http://forum.gsmhosting.com/vbb/showthread.php?t=398297 2. if not helps, please read: C:\Program Files\InfinityBox\pinout\ChineseMiracle\ 3. if not helps, please read: http:///vbb/showpo...36&postcount=7 4. if not helps, please read: http:///vbb/showthread.php?t=433447 |
